A small airplane crashed in the Hollywood area of St. Mary's County, Maryland, on Saturday morning, killing the pilot. The plane was located about 10.20. The pilot's identity has not been disclosed. No one else was on board during the crash. The sheriff's office received multiple 911 calls about a possible plane crash.
